Introduction to Trim Beads
Trim beads, also known as stop beads or plaster beads, are small, thin strips of metal or plastic used to finish and reinforce the edges of drywall, plaster, or stucco surfaces. They are typically installed at the edges of walls, ceilings, and around windows and doors to create a smooth, even finish and to prevent the plaster or drywall from cracking or chipping. Trim beads play a critical role in ensuring the structural integrity and aesthetic appeal of buildings, making them an essential component in construction projects.
Types of Trim Beads
There are several types of trim beads available, each designed to cater to specific construction needs and applications. Some of the most common types of trim beads include:
- Perimeter trim beads: These are used to finish the edges of drywall and plaster surfaces, creating a clean, smooth edge.
- Corner trim beads: As the name suggests, these are used to finish and reinforce the corners of walls, ceilings, and other surfaces.
- Expansion trim beads: These are designed to allow for expansion and contraction of surfaces due to temperature changes, making them ideal for use in areas with high temperature fluctuations.
Materials Used for Trim Beads
Trim beads can be made from a variety of materials, depending on their intended application and the desired level of durability. Some of the most common materials used for trim beads include:
Metal (aluminum or steel): These are durable, long-lasting, and resistant to corrosion, making them a popular choice for construction projects.
Plastic: Plastic trim beads are lightweight, easy to install, and resistant to rust and corrosion, making them suitable for use in areas with high humidity levels.
PVC: PVC trim beads are durable, flexible, and resistant to moisture, making them ideal for use in areas with high water exposure, such as bathrooms and kitchens.

Installation Process
The installation process for trim beads typically involves several steps, including measuring, cutting, and attaching the trim beads to the surface using a suitable adhesive or fastening system. It is essential to follow the manufacturer’s instructions and recommendations for installation to ensure a strong, durable bond. Some of the key considerations when installing trim beads include:
Ensuring the surface is clean, dry, and free of debris
Measuring and cutting the trim beads accurately to fit the edges of the surface
Applying the adhesive or fastening system correctly to ensure a strong bond
Allowing the adhesive or fastening system to dry or set according to the manufacturer’s instructions
Tools and Equipment Required
The tools and equipment required for installing trim beads typically include:
Tape measure
Cutting tools (e.g., snips or a utility knife)
Adhesive or fastening system (e.g., nails or screws)
Level
Pencil or marker
